Sans Contrasted Isgo 8 is a very bold, very wide, very high cont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A slanted, extended sans with sharp, aerodynamic construction and pronounced internal cut-ins that create a segmented, machined look. Strokes are heavy and compact, with noticeable thick–thin transitions expressed through angled terminals and carved counters rather than smooth modulation. Corners tend toward crisp angles with occasional rounded joins, and many forms use squared bowls and diagonally sliced ends to emphasize forward motion. The overall rhythm is tight and dense, producing a strong, blocky texture that stays consistent across capitals, lowercase, and numerals.

Best suited to display settings where impact and motion are desired: headlines, posters, esports or sports identities, gaming UI accents, and automotive or motorsport-inspired graphics. It also works for short labels, badges, and titling in tech or industrial contexts, especially at larger sizes where the cut-in details remain clear.

The tone is fast, assertive, and mechanical, evoking motorsport graphics, sci‑fi interfaces, and industrial labeling. Its forward slant and sharp cutaways suggest speed and power, while the uniform, high-impact silhouettes feel engineered and tactical rather than friendly or neutral.

Designed to project speed and engineered precision through slanted, extended proportions and angular, carved detailing. The letterforms aim for a distinctive, high-energy voice that reads as modern and performance-driven rather than text-neutral.

Lowercase and uppercase share a similarly forceful, display-oriented presence, and several glyphs rely on distinctive internal notches and apertures that prioritize style over open readability at small sizes. Numerals echo the same slashed, streamlined logic, helping the set feel cohesive in headings and short numeric strings.
